Preparation Tips: Bring ID, wear accessible clothing, and arrive 15 minutes early

When scheduling your vaccine appointment at Mercedes-Benz Stadium, it’s essential to prepare properly to ensure a smooth and efficient experience. One of the most critical preparation tips is to bring a valid form of identification. This could be your driver’s license, state ID, passport, or any government-issued ID. Having your ID on hand is crucial for verifying your appointment and personal details, as it helps the staff confirm your eligibility and registration. Without proper identification, you may face delays or even be turned away, so double-check that you have it before leaving home.

Another important aspect of preparation is wearing accessible clothing. Since you’ll be receiving a vaccine, typically in the arm, it’s best to wear a short-sleeved shirt or a top that can easily be rolled up. This simple choice saves time during the vaccination process and ensures comfort for both you and the healthcare provider. Avoid wearing tight or layered clothing that might make it difficult to access your upper arm quickly. Comfortable attire also helps you feel at ease during your visit to the stadium.

Frequently asked questions

Visit the official website of the vaccine provider operating at Mercedes-Benz Stadium or check the Georgia Department of Public Health’s website for scheduling links. Follow the prompts to select a date and time.

The available vaccines may vary, but typically include COVID-19 vaccines (Pfizer, Moderna, Johnson & Johnson). Check the scheduling platform or contact the provider for specific vaccine options.

While insurance is not required, bringing a valid ID and insurance card (if applicable) is recommended. Vaccines are free, but insurance may be billed for administrative costs.

While some walk-in options may be available, it’s best to schedule an appointment to ensure availability. Check the provider’s website or call ahead for walk-in details.
